Keeping your Opel or Vauxhall navigation system up to date is crucial for smooth travels across Europe. The system, particularly the refined 2.5 version found in many 2014-2018 models (like Insignia, Astra, and Mokka), requires periodic map updates to maintain accuracy.

The only legitimate source for downloading Navi 900 IntelliLink map updates is the official Opel Navigation Store. You can access it by visiting .
